When to use each calculation?

Use the mean for datasets with a normal distribution and no outliers. The median is better suited for datasets with outliers or skewed distributions. The mode is ideal for categorical data or when there are multiple peaks in the dataset.

In the US, the importance of statistics is reflected in various industries, including business, finance, healthcare, and education. With the rise of big data, companies and organizations are leveraging statistical analysis to gain insights into consumer behavior, market trends, and employee performance. As a result, the demand for skilled data analysts and statisticians is increasing, making it a trending topic in the US.

While all three measures describe the center of a dataset, they have distinct characteristics. The mean is sensitive to outliers, the median is more robust, and the mode represents the most frequent value.
